Start on Chet's Dream (chair 1) blues and blacks off of that. If conditions are decent Chair 9 will take you to the top of the ridge where you can hike to some more fun steeps. Far to the north side are lists 4 & 8, which can access some fun stuff as well.
While in the area, Arapahoe Basin is just on the other side of Loveland Pass and definitely warrants a visit
Good beta above. Steeps off 1 are getting a refresh and skied good this weekend. South Chutes off of Ptarmigan often hold good, mellow turns this time of year. Be aware off 4/8 East/West Ropes is closed down for the season, as is the Face. Plenty of incoming snow for coverage. But you may be chasing solar aspects for softening depending on how warm it gets 4/18-4/20.
